Latest Patents

Ohkubo's latest patents include a manufacturing method for an electron source, which involves a series of precise steps. The method begins with cutting out a chip from a block of electron emission material. This is followed by fixing one end of the chip to a support needle and sharpening the other end. The process utilizes an ion beam to create grooves in the block, ensuring that the chip's surfaces form a specific angle. Additionally, he has developed emitters that include nanoneedles and nanowires made from single crystal materials, which are designed to emit electrons with high efficiency. These innovations are crucial for the development of advanced electron guns and electronic devices.
